Super Moist Spice Cake
Warmly spiced cake loaded with applesauce and shredded fruit, crowned with creamy frosting for irresistible moisture in every bite.

Ingredients
1
2 and 1/2 cups (313g) all-purpose flour (spooned & leveled)
2
2 teaspoons baking powder
3
1 teaspoon baking soda
4
1/2 teaspoon salt
5
1 and 1/2 teaspoon ground cinnamon
6
1 teaspoon ground ginger
7
1/2 teaspoon ground nutmeg
8
1/2 teaspoon ground cloves
9
1 cup (240ml) vegetable oil
10
1 and 3/4 cup (350g) packed light or dark brown sugar
11
1 cup (240g) unsweetened applesauce
12
4 large eggs
13
2 teaspoons pure vanilla extract
14
1 cup (150g) shredded apple (or shredded carrot/zucchini)
15
optional: 1 Tablespoon (21g) unsulphured or dark molasses (not blackstrap; I prefer Grandma’s brand)
16
1/4 cup (4 Tbsp; 56g) unsalted butter, cut into 4 slices
17
8 ounces (226g) full-fat brick cream cheese, softened to room temperature
18
2 and 1/2 cups (300g) confectioners’ sugar
19
1 teaspoon pure vanilla extract
20
pinch of salt
21
optional, for garnish: sprinkle of ground cinnamon or nutmeg
